A sweet, rhythmic story about a polite tortoise saying goodbye around the zoo. The animal wordplay gives it a fun read-aloud feel, while the gentle structure keeps the whole episode playful, kind, and easy to follow.

This episode is part of StoryBeam, the daily story podcast co-hosted by a mom and her young daughter at the heart of StoryBeam Kids — a closed, parent-reviewed audio app with no open search and no algorithmic next-up.

For grown-ups

What to expect in this episode

A tortoise says rhyming goodbyes to every animal friend and nearly misses his own adventure. The shortest episode, wall-to-wall wordplay. Nothing to flag.

The moral: Friends make leaving hard — but don't let the goodbyes eat the adventure.
